debuggingpowershell init

我的问题是,我刚刚重新安装我的系统,并通过巧克力装了一堆包。 然而,现在当我启动powershell时,控制台内最简单的types和大小改变为栅格和16pt(巨大和丑陋),即使我的控制台默认是truetype和14pt。 即使我在Documents / PowerShell / …下有我的configuration文件,所有这些都会被注释掉,而且我使用“@powershell”或“powershell.exe”从常规控制台启动它。

任何人都可以告诉我如何去find这个问题? 正如我在运行的configuration文件脚本链中看到的那样,摆弄字体的东西就是poshgit安装,但正如我所说,即使我已经禁用了所有这些脚本(看起来),仍然会改变字体。

编辑:我发现,即使在虚拟机中干净的安装也是一样的。 那么如何在Powershell中设置字体呢? 我已经做了所有的事情,很多教程都说点击的方式,但它不是持久的。

任何人都可以帮我吗?

先谢谢你,玛蒂

有几个PowerShellconfiguration文件。 我build议你检查所有的代码,看看是否已经添加了代码。 例如,使用记事本,您可以执行以下操作:

> notepad $profile.AllUsersAllHosts > notepad $profile.AllUsersCurrentHost > notepad $profile.CurrentUserAllHosts > notepad $profile.CurrentUserCurrentHost 

我发现其他人都有同样的问题,只是关键字是Lucida控制台。

这家伙也有类似的问题。 改变大小并没有解决我的问题,但如果我改为常规Lucida字体types,而不是Lucida控制台,它是持久的。 Lucida控制台必须干扰系统的其他部分,导致powershell退回到光栅字体。

虽然这不是一个解释,但这是一个可行的妥协。